Adjustable Lumbar Support
Adjustable lumbar support is indispensable for customizing the lower back area of an ergonomic office chair, ensuring better spinal alignment and reduced fatigue during long hours of sitting. I look for multi-directional adjustments—up/down, forward/backward, and tilt—so I can tailor the support to my unique body shape and sitting preferences. Proper placement and firmness of the lumbar support are essential; they help alleviate lower back pain and promote a healthy posture, especially during extended work sessions. Some chairs even feature mechanisms that automatically conform to my spine’s natural curve, providing consistent support without constant readjustment. Personalized lumbar support not only boosts comfort but also reduces musculoskeletal issues over time, making it a significant factor when selecting a premium ergonomic chair.

Seat Depth & Height
Selecting the right seat depth and height is essential for maintaining comfort and proper posture during long hours at your desk. The ideal seat height lets your feet rest flat on the floor, with knees at a 90-degree angle, promoting good circulation. Adjustable seat height is a must, so you can personalize your setup for maximum comfort. Seat depth should be around 17 to 20 inches, providing full thigh support without pressing against the back of your knees or restricting movement. Proper adjustments help align your hips, lower back, and legs, reducing strain and fatigue. Chairs with customizable seat depth and height features allow you to fine-tune your position, ensuring ergonomic support tailored to your body and workspace needs.

Recline & Tilt Function
A chair’s recline and tilt functions play a essential role in supporting my comfort and posture throughout the workday. An adjustable recline angle from 90° to 135° lets me find the perfect position for working, relaxing, or even taking a quick nap. Tilt lock mechanisms are indispensable, as they allow me to secure the chair at specific angles, providing stability when needed. Multi-position tilt settings encourage dynamic sitting, helping reduce fatigue by shifting postures regularly. Advanced tilt tension controls are a game-changer—they let me adjust the resistance, ensuring smooth, effortless movement that matches my body weight. Being able to seamlessly switch between upright and reclined positions keeps my spine supported and promotes movement, which is fundamental for ergonomic health and reducing strain during long hours at my desk.
Weight Capacity & Stability
Choosing a premium ergonomic office chair means paying close attention to its weight capacity and stability features. A higher weight capacity, around 300 to 440 pounds, guarantees the chair can support a wide range of users securely. Stability is vital, often reinforced by a heavy-duty, five-point steel base with durable casters that prevent wobbling during movement. A robust build with reinforced frame components reduces the risk of structural failure under heavy loads. Certifications like BIFMA and SGS confirm that the chair meets safety and stability standards. Proper weight distribution and a stable center of gravity help prevent tipping or tipping-over, especially with adjustable recline and footrests. These features are essential for both safety and long-term durability.
